It can dump the full disassembled memory to a text file or access it in real time. Sound emulation using SDL Audio and Gb_Snd_Emu library.Mix frames: Mimics the LCD ghosting effect seen in the original Game Boy.Background, window and sprites, with correct timings and priorities including mid-scanline timing. Memory Bank Controllers (MBC1, MBC2, MBC3 with RTC, MBC5), ROM + RAM and multicart cartridges.Accurate instruction and memory timing, passes instr_timing.gb and mem_timing.gb from blargg's tests.Highly accurate CPU emulation, passes cpu_instrs.gb from blargg's tests.Optimized projects are provided for Raspberry Pi 1, 2 and 3.
